Materials Needed

  • Yarn: Worsted weight cotton yarn (choose your favorite color)
  • Hook: 4.0 mm crochet hook
  • Additional Supplies:
    • Scissors
    • Tapestry needle for weaving in ends
    • Hair clip (available at craft stores)
    • Hot glue gun or sewing thread (for attaching the clip)

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Start with a Magic Ring:

    To create a magic ring, wrap the yarn around your fingers to form a loop. Insert your hook into the loop, yarn over, and pull through to create a slip knot. This will be the foundation of your hair clip.

  2. Round 1:

    Chain 1 (Ch 1), then work 8 single crochets (sc) into the magic ring. To close the round, join with a slip stitch (sl st) to the first single crochet. You should have 8 stitches in total.

  3. Round 2:

    Ch 1, then work 2 single crochets in each stitch around. Join with a slip stitch to the first single crochet. You will have 16 stitches at the end of this round.

  4. Round 3:

    Ch 1, then work (sc in the next stitch, 2 sc in the next stitch) around. Join with a slip stitch to the first single crochet. You should have 24 stitches now.

  5. Round 4:

    Ch 1, then work a single crochet in each stitch around. Join with a slip stitch to the first single crochet. This round will help to create a solid base for your hair clip.

  6. Finish Off:

    Once you have completed Round 4, fasten off your work by cutting the yarn, leaving a long tail. Use your tapestry needle to weave in any loose ends for a clean finish.

  7. Attach the Hair Clip:

    Using a hot glue gun or sewing thread, securely attach the hair clip to the back of your crocheted piece. Ensure it is firmly in place so that it can hold your hair comfortably.
